The simulator covers the destination-control algorithms, the traffic-pattern generators, and the regression scenarios used to validate dispatch changes before deployment. Please keep the scenario library deterministic — seeded runs only — and document any new traffic profiles in the maintainers' wiki. Pending work includes the express-zone refactor and flaky peak-hour tests. Effective next Monday, full responsibility transfers to the person named below.

named custodian: Brivan Eliath Quenox Frador

Step 4: Deploying Chirpwatch, the deploy-status chat bot. Build the container from the release branch and push it to the Vellum Systems registry. The bot announces rollout progress to the #releases channel, so confirm the channel mapping in config/announce.yaml before promoting. The release artifact must be signed before the registry will accept it. Use the signing key below.

signing key of fawif-fafog = bky13_mbeCN7uvMrNDc

## Changelog — Forgeline CI 4.2.0: clock skew defaults tightened

Previous releases tolerated up to 300 seconds of clock skew between build agents when validating signed artifact timestamps, which weakened replay detection. As of 4.2.0, the tolerance is reduced and NTP health checks gate agent enrollment. Reviewers should note these are now enforced, not advisory. The new default values are listed below.

deployment values, yahag-tawef:
ZORWYN_HOST=zorwyn.tolvaqlabs.internal
ZORWYN_PORT=9300